Understanding Button Quail Eggs

Button quail eggs are significantly smaller than the average chicken egg, usually measuring about the size of a dime. Their small size and beautiful, speckled appearance make them instantly recognizable. These eggs are laid by the female button quail and can vary in color from shades of brown to a bluish tint, with dark spots.

Incubation and Care

Incubating button quail eggs requires attention to detail and the right equipment. The ideal incubation temperature is between 99.5°F to 100°F with a humidity level around 60% for the first 14 days, then increased to about 70% for the last few days until hatching. It’s crucial to turn the eggs at least 3 times a day to ensure proper development, though many experienced breeders opt for automatic incubators to maintain consistency.

Why Raise Button Quail?

Aside from their adorable size and the joy of hatching them, button quails have several benefits. They mature quickly, often starting to lay eggs at just 6 weeks of age. Their eggs, while small, are edible and considered a delicacy in some cultures. Additionally, button quails require minimal space, making them perfect for those with limited room who wish to keep birds.
